Component | FUEL SYSTEM, GASOLINE:CARBURETOR SYSTEM |
---|---|
Manufacturer | CHRYSLER CORPORATION |
Mfr Report Date | 19740801 |
NHTSA Campaign ID | 78V020000 |
Summary | WHEN THE ACCELERATOR PEDAL ON THE INVOLVED VEHICLES IS DEPRESSED AND THE ACCELERATOR PUMP IS ACTIVATED, A DISTORTED ACCELERATOR PUMP SEAL IN THE CARBURETOR MAY PREVENT THE PUMP FROM DELIVERING THE PROPER AMOUNT OF FUEL. |
Remedy | DEALER WILL REPLACE THE CARBURETOR ACCELERATOR PUMP SEAL WITH A SEAL OF IMPROVED DISTORTION RESISTANCE. THE CARBURETOR WILL ALSO BE CHECKED FOR THE PROPER FLOAT LEVEL. |
Notes | VEHICLE DESCRIPTION: PASSENGER VEHICLES EQUIPPED WITH 225 OR 318 CID ENGINES.SYSTEM: FUEL; CARBURETOR ACCELERATOR PUMP SEAL.CONSEQUENCES OF DEFECT: THIS MAY RESULT IN HESITATION OR LACK OF RESPONSE WHENDRIVER ATTEMPTS TO ACCELERATE. ENGINE STALLING MAY OCCUR IN SOME CASES; THISCOULD LEAD TO A VEHICLE ACCIDENT IN CERTAIN TRAFFIC SITUATIONS. |

What are the dimension and mechanical specifications of the 1976 Dodge Monaco?
Q: What is the wheelbase size of the 1976 Dodge Monaco? A: The 1976 Dodge Monaco has wheelbase sizes of 121.50 and 124.00 inches.Q: What is the length of the 1976 Dodge Monaco? A: The 1976 Dodge Monaco has lengths of 225.70 and 229.50 inches.Q: What is the width of the 1976 Dodge Monaco? A: The 1976 Dodge Monaco has a width of 79.40 inches.Q: How much did the 1976 Dodge Monaco cost when new?A: The 1976 Dodge Monaco cost approximately $4,380 to $5,870 (USD) when new.Q: What were the bodystyles of the 1976 Dodge Monaco? A: The 1976 Dodge Monaco was offered as a Royal Brougham Formal Hardtop, Royal Brougham Sedan, Royal Brougham Three-Seater Wagon, Royal Hardtop Coupe, Royal Sedan, Royal Station wagon, Royal Three Seater Station Wagon, Sedan, Station Wagon.Q: How many vehicles did Dodge produce in 1976? A: Dodge produced 430,641 automobiles in 1976.Q: What engines did the 1976 Dodge Monaco have? A: The 1976 Dodge Monaco had the following engine options: V 8 (5211 cc | 318.0 cu in. | 5.2 L.) with 150 BHP (110.4 KW) @ 4000 RPM and 255 Ft-Lbs (346 NM) @ 1600 RPM V 8 (5899 cc | 360.0 cu in. | 5.9 L.) with 170 HP (125.12 KW) @ 4000 RPM and 280 Ft-Lbs (380 NM) @ 2400 RPM V 8 (5899 cc | 360.0 cu in. | 5.9 L.) with 175 HP (128.8 KW) @ 4000 RPM and 280 Ft-Lbs (380 NM) @ 2400 RPM V 8 (6555 cc | 400.0 cu in. | 6.6 L.) with 175 HP (128.8 KW) @ 4000 RPM and 300 Ft-Lbs (407 NM) @ 2400 RPM V 8 (6555 cc | 400.0 cu in. | 6.6 L.) with 185 HP (136.16 KW) @ 3600 RPM and 285 Ft-Lbs (386 NM) @ 3200 RPM V 8 (7210 cc | 440.0 cu in. | 7.2 L.) with 205 HP (150.88 KW) @ 3600 RPM and 320 Ft-Lbs (434 NM) @ 2000 RPM V 8 (6555 cc | 400.0 cu in. | 6.6 L.) with 210 HP (154.56 KW) @ 4400 RPM and 305 Ft-Lbs (414 NM) @ 3200 RPM V 8 (6555 cc | 400.0 cu in. | 6.6 L.) with 240 HP (176.64 KW) @ 4400 RPM and 325 Ft-Lbs (441 NM) @ 3200 RPM Q: What transmission did the 1976 Dodge Monaco have? A: The 1976 Dodge Monaco had a 3 speed Automatic gearbox.
